Honeywell’s SNG-Q Series Quadrature
Speed and Direction Sensors are
designed to provide both speed and
direction information. Speed is provided
from digital square wave outputs;
direction is provided using a quadrature
output with signals 90° phase shifted
from each other. With the quadrature
output, target direction is determined by
output lead/lag phase shifting.

POTENTIAL APPLICATIONS
Industrial:
• AC induction motors in material
handling, agriculture, and construction
machines: May be used to help control
power delivered by the ac induction
motor
• Escalators and elevators: May be used
to help control speed and position
Transportation:
• Hybrid electric transmissions in heavy
duty trucks, buses, agriculture and
construction machines: May be used
to help control power regulation of the
hybrid system
• Wheel speed detection in material
handling, agriculture, and construction
machines: May be used to detect the
speed and direction of the wheels,
which translates to the speed and
direction of the machine
• Hybrid engines in heavy duty trucks,
buses, agriculture and construction
machines: May be used to help control
power regulation of the hybrid system
Not recommended for Aerospace or
Defense applications
